Documents are required
The process of getting a Polish driving license is a challenge, time consuming, and nerve wracking. A Polish driving license is required to be able to take advantage of Poland's rich culture. It is important to understand the nuances before you begin the process of applying.
Getting your Polish driver's license begins by filling out an official PKK (driver profile for a prospective driver). This form can be found on the internet as well as at local offices. Along with the PKK filled out, you will also need a valid ID and a medical certification stating that you are able to drive. Also, you will need a recent color photograph measuring 3.5 cm by 4.5 cm. You will also need to submit proof of residence in Poland. This could be a copy of your passport or kup Prawo jazdy online a resident registration or a visa.

In addition to the submission of a PKK, you will need to present an ID with a valid validity, a medical certificate that you are able to drive, and a current photo in color (size 3,5 cm x 4,5 cm). For minors, a signed consent from an adult or legal guardian is required. Additionally, you have to take internal exams, which are held in driving schools and are designed to be as close to official exams as is possible. The cost of the test is PLN 200.
